Clarke beaming after BMW Asian Open win

4/27/2008

Irish eyes were smiling once again for Darren Clarke when he claimed an emotional victory with a heroic final-hole birdie at the BMW Asian Open

The Ulsterman drained a 40 foot putt on the 18th hole to beat a gallant Robert-Jan Derksen of The Netherlands by one shot and win his first European Tour title in nearly five years at Tomson Shanghai Pudong Golf Club.
 
It marked a welcome return to the winners’ circle for Clarke, who has endured a difficult past few years following the death of his wife Heather through cancer in 2006 and a subsequent dip in form.
 
Clarke carded a final round of one over par 73 in tough conditions for an eight under par 280 aggregate to secure his 11th career victory on The European Tour and his first since the 2003 WGC – NEC Invitational.

England’s Robert Dinwiddie secured his highest finish since graduating from the Challenge Tour last season after a round of 74 put him in a share of third place alongside Italy’s Francesco Molinari and Chinese Taipei’s Lin Wen-tang, who holed a 25-foot birdie on the 18th to finish as the top Asian in the event sanctioned by The European Tour, Asian Tour and China Golf Association.

But they were mere bit players as a dramatic final afternoon unfolded in China. Clarke looked to have it won before dropping shots at the 16th and 17th put him level with the Dutchman playing the final hole.

Derksen’s second from the fairway bunker bounced over the back but he played a sublime chip for a tap-in par. But Clarke was not to be denied and rammed home a 40 foot putt to claim the title.

Leaderboard – Final:

1. Darren Clarke                    NIR  71 69 67 73 280 - 8
2. Robert-Jan Derksen           NED  70 69 69 73 281 - 7
3. Robert Dinwiddie                ENG  70 73 66 74 283 - 5
    Francesco Molinari              ITA  71 75 68 69 283 - 5
    Lin Wen-Tang                    TPE  71 71 69 72 283 - 5
6. Henrik Stenson                  SWE  68 76 72 68 284 - 4
7. John Bickerton                   ENG  71 75 69 70 285 - 3
    Martin Kaymer                   GER  72 72 74 67 285 - 3
9. Scott Hend                        AUS  69 74 71 72 286 - 2
    Peter Lawrie                       IRL  72 74 70 70 286 - 2
